After weeks of extensive testing of both commercial and backyard flocks within the surveillance zones established in Alabama, there has been no new detection of avian influenza. Commissioner of Agriculture and Industries John McMillan, in consultation with state veterinarian Dr. Tony Frazier, officially rescinds the Order Prohibiting Poultry Exhibitions and the Assembly of Poultry to be Sold in Alabama*. Poultry Producers Reminded of Stop Movement Order in Alabama
The Alabama Department of Agriculture and Industries issued a stop movement order this week for certain poultry in the state because of three ongoing investigations of avian influenza in north Alabama. ACA President Hopes Producers Will Attend Annual Convention
The 74th Alabama Cattlemen’s Association (ACA) Convention and Trade Show will be held this week, February 15-16, at the Renaissance Hotel and Montgomery Convention Center in downtown Montgomery. ACA President Bill Lipscomb hopes cattle producers from across Alabama will attend.
